Country Music Legends Tour Across US, Canada
Country music continues to thrive both in legacy and innovation, with legendary artists like Willie Nelson and Garth Brooks actively touring and energizing fans with their live performances. The 1970s are often hailed as the genre's golden era, featuring groundbreaking tracks such as Dolly Parton's "Jolene" and Waylon Jennings' "Waymore’s Blues," highlighting the period's musical and lyrical experimentation. Dolly Parton is recognized as a pioneer in blending country with pop, paving the way for modern crossover artists who push the boundaries of the genre, a tradition also exemplified by Glen Campbell and Kenny Rogers. Emmylou Harris, a seasoned country artist, regards Merle Haggard as a quintessential figure whose work encapsulates the essence of country music. This enduring appeal of country music, coupled with its evolving nature, keeps it relevant and beloved, as seen in the continued success of tours and residencies by veteran artists. These elements collectively underscore country music's rich history and its adaptive, genre-crossing future.
